In the quest for sustainable solutions to global energy needs, biomass boilers have emerged as a forefront technology.Compared with traditional coal-fired and oil-fired boilers, they have significant advantages in environmental protection.
Common types of biomass fuels include wood chips, wood pellets,wood blocks, agricultural waste like straw and husk and recycled materials.This diversity in fuel types makes biomass boilers highly adaptable to different regional resources.

1.Carbon Cycle
Unlike fossil fuel systems, biomass boilers emit significantly lower levels of carbon dioxide. And carbon dioxide released during combustion can be offset by the carbon dioxide absorbed during the growth of new biomass, minimising the carbon footprint.
Biomass fuels participate in a short carbon cycle. That means the carbon released during combustion is recently absorbed by the plant or organic material—typically within months or a few years. Fossil fuels, in contrast, release carbon stored for millions of years, which adds to the atmospheric CO₂ burden.
2.Resource Renewability
One of the most defining advantages of biomass is resource renewability.Biomass is harvested on an ongoing basis through sustainable forestry(Wood waste from lumber processing,sawdust and pellets from furniture and flooring industries), crop waste(corn stalks, sugarcane bagasse).
Industrial biomass boilers generate far less toxic ash compared to fossil fuel systems. The residual ash from biomass is often rich in minerals like potassium, calcium, and phosphorous, making it suitable for soil amendments,fertilizer in agriculture.
3.Improve Air Quality
With advancements in filtration and emission control technologies, the output of particulate matter and other harmful pollutants has been significantly reduced,improve regional air quality.
It produces almost no sulfur dioxide during combustion, which can greatly reduce the formation of acid rain.
4.Reduced Reliance On Fossil Fuels
By adopting a biomass boiler, you decrease dependence on fossil fuels, ease the tension of energy supply.
At the same time reduce environmental damage caused by the exploitation and transportation of fossil energy, ensuring energy security and ecological security.
5.Improved Energy Efficiency
Modern biomass boiler systems are meticulously designed to achieve higher fuel-to-energy conversion rates.And maximize the extraction of energy from biomass through advanced combustion technology.
This efficiency results in reduced energy wastage and ultimately lowers overall energy consumption.
6.Use Of Agricultural Waste
In agricultural production, waste such as corn stalks are often produced,
some of it gets burned in open fields, releasing smoke and toxic gas into the air.
But biomass production line plant brings a valuable fuel source from it, reduces emissions.
7.Industrial Application
Chemical industry: can replace part of fossil energy to provide clean heat for chemical production.
Building materials industry: can achieve clean heating and at the same time absorb waste residue and waste generated during building materials production.
Textile industry: provide steam for heating and drying for printing, dyeing, spinning and other processes.
Food processing industry: provide steam for sterilization, drying, cooking and other processes.
Paper making industry: recycling waste generated in the production process such as waste wood, sawdust, rice husk etc.
